| SENATE RESOLUTION
| 2 |
| WHEREAS, The members of the Illinois Senate are saddened to | 3 |
| learn of the death of James T. Sweeney of Crest Hill, who | 4 |
| passed away on February 1, 2010; and
| 5 |
| WHEREAS, He was born October 8, 1945, and married Charlene | 6 |
| Hanus on August 27, 1977 at St. Stephen Catholic Church in | 7 |
| Joliet; he was an avid reader and air show enthusiast; he | 8 |
| enjoyed vacationing in the Smoky Mountains and visiting Army, | 9 |
| Air Force, and Navy military bases; and
| 10 |
| WHEREAS, He was retired from the United States Army, | 11 |
| serving in Vietnam from September 28, 1966 thru November 27, | 12 |
| 1967; February 16, 1968 thru May 12, 1968; and December 11, | 13 |
| 1969 thru November 15, 1970; he also served in Indochina and | 14 |
| Korea; he proudly served with the 1st Cavalry Division, 101st | 15 |
| Airborne Division, and 1st Aviation Brigade; and
| 16 |
| WHEREAS, He was awarded the Vietnam Service Medal with 1 | 17 |
| Silver Service Star; Vietnam Campaign Medal with 60 Device, | 18 |
| National Defense Service Medal; 3 O/S Bars; Air Medal (5th | 19 |
| Award); Aircraft Crewman Badge; Army Commendation Medal; | 20 |
| Meritorious Unit Citation; Bronze Star Medal; Good Conduct | 21 |
| Medal; Armed Forces Expeditionary Medal (Korea); Marksman | 22 |
